Scenario

Ontario is supporting researchers to make new discoveries that will benefit people, through funding for projects across the province. Ontario's support will help researchers across the province build teams, and cover the costs of research equipment and facilities, leading to new products and services, companies and jobs in fields like health care, advanced manufacturing, clean tech and computer technology.

Ontario has three flagship programs that support world-class academic research at its universities, colleges, and research hospitals: Early Researcher Awards (ERA), Ontario Research Fund - Research Excellence (ORF-RE) and Ontario Research Fund - Research Infrastructure (ORF-RI).
